Benedetto da Maiano (1442 – May 24, 1497) was an Italian sculptor of the early Renaissance. Naples (Napoli, Napule or; Neapolis; lit) is the regional capital of Campania and the third-largest municipality in Italy after Rome and Milan.

Sant'Anna dei Lombardi

Sant'Anna dei Lombardi,, and also known as Santa Maria di Monte Oliveto, is an ancient church and convent in located in Piazza Monteoliveto in central Naples, Italy.
